Özden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Özden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name Özden (Arabic: اوزدين) occurs more in Turkey more than any other country or territory. It may appear in the variant forms: Ozden. Click here for other potential spellings of this last name.

How Common Is The Last Name Özden? popularity and diffusion

The surname Özden is the 13,568th most prevalent last name at a global level, held by around 1 in 177,183 people. Özden is predominantly found in Asia, where 85 percent of Özden reside; 85 percent reside in West Asia and 85 percent reside in Anatolia and Highlands. Özden is also the 38,800th most frequently occurring first name world-wide, borne by 19,338 people.

The last name Özden is most common in Turkey, where it is held by 40,664 people, or 1 in 1,914. In Turkey it is most numerous in: Istanbul Province, where 17 percent are found, Ankara Province, where 9 percent are found and Izmir Province, where 5 percent are found. Besides Turkey this last name exists in 20 countries. It is also common in Germany, where 1 percent are found and Northern Cyprus, where 0 percent are found.
